New Zealand scraps plan to tax livestock burps, farts

New legislation will be introduced to parliament this month to remove the agriculture sector from a new emissions pricing plan, it said. "The government is committed to meeting our climate change obligations without shutting down Kiwi farms," said Agriculture Minister Todd McClay. "It doesn't make sense to send jobs and production overseas, while less carbon-efficient countries produce the food the world needs." Codelco copper output hit by lingering effects of rock collapse

Codelco attributed a sharp drop in production at its top mine to the lingering effects of a rock collapse last year as the world’s No. 1 copper supplier strives to reverse slumping output. “This situation was foreseen in annual planning and does not affect the committed production budget,” the state-owned company said in a written response to questions about the massive El Teniente mine.

Universities will be allowed to offer admissions twice a year on lines of foreign varsities: UGC

Indian universities and higher education institutions will be allowed to offer biannual admissions twice a year, similar to foreign universities. The two admission cycles will be July-August and January-February from the 2024-25 academic session. This will benefit students who missed admission in the July-August session due to delays in board results, health issues, or personal reasons.
